Spotware, the company behind the popular cTrader trading platform, has announced a new integration with iSAM Securities, a specialist provider of execution and risk management solutions. The partnership aims to give brokers advanced risk tools and smarter execution insights—directly embedded into the cTrader ecosystem.

The integration connects cTrader with two of iSAM Securities’ flagship products: Surge, a newly launched automation-driven book management platform, and Radar, a real-time risk monitoring engine. These tools allow brokers to better assess liquidity, optimize execution strategies, and streamline daily operations without relying on external infrastructure or add-ons.

“With this integration clients can take advantage of innovative and market-leading tools to manage sharp flow and optimize their B-Book,” said Dennis Weissert, Chief Commercial Officer, iSAM Apex. “We provide institutional tools with multi-layered redundancy – tailored to serve the retail market.”

Surge offers powerful automation capabilities, combining analytics, client classification, execution rule application, and bridge updates—all within a single platform. Meanwhile, Radar supports real-time oversight of trading activity, liquidity conditions, and arbitrage risks, helping brokers identify profit opportunities through enhanced slippage analysis and quote behavior tracking.

For Spotware, the integration aligns with its Open Trading Platform™ model, which supports over 100 third-party tools.

“Integrating iSAM Securities’ technologies aligns with our Open Trading Platform™ approach, which powers over 100 third-party integrations,” said Yiota Hadjilouka, COO of Spotware. “This partnership highlights our continued commitment to delivering top-tier solutions, reinforcing cTrader’s position at the forefront of the industry.”

By embedding iSAM Securities’ capabilities, cTrader offers brokers an expanded toolset that improves transparency, boosts execution quality, and enhances risk oversight across the entire trading lifecycle.
